#fb8d8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b8d8e is composed of 98.4% red, 55.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.8%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 359.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 76.9%. #fb8d8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f71b1d.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#fb8d8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fb8d8e has RGB values of R:251, G:141,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.43,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16485774.

Shades and Tints of #fb8d8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130101 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b8d8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c3c3 is the less saturated color, while #fb8d8e is the most saturated one.
